In James H Donald (Darvel) Limited v HMRC [2017] TC05908 the First Tier Tax Tribunal (FTT) considered whether tax self assessed by related companies could be offset against a liability incurred by a different company following an enquiry.

In David Benton, Steve Jackson, Paul Hudson v HMRC [2017] participants in tax schemes tried to bar HMRC from their penalty appeals on the basis that Follower Notices were invalid.

Now that the election is over, we can look forward to a mini-budget and another finance bill to legislate all those things that were missed off the last Finance Act. We expect the undoing of what was originally billed as a triple lock on income tax, VAT and NICs and also more 'stealth taxes' (penalties).
The Pensions Regulator has netted more than £6 million in fines following compulsory pensions auto-enrolment for employers.
